3. Modulation of B cell access to antigen by passively administered antibodies : an explanation for antibody feedback regulation?
Sammanfattning : Antibody responses can be up- or down-regulated by passive administration of specific antibody together with antigen. Depending on the structure of the antigen and the antibody isotype, responses can be completely suppressed or enhanced up to a 1000-fold of what is seen in animals immunized with antigen alone. 4. Stereotyped B Cell Receptors in Chronic Lymphocytic Leukaemia : Implications for Antigen Selection in Leukemogenesis
Sammanfattning : Biased immunoglobulin heavy variable (IGHV) gene usage and distinctive B-cell receptor (BCR) features have been reported in chronic lymphocytic leukaemia (CLL), which may reflect clonal selection by antigens during disease development. Furthermore, the IGHV gene mutation status distinguishes two clinical entities of CLL, where patients with unmutated IGHV genes have an inferior prognosis compared to those with mutated IGHV genes. 5. Immunoglobulin Gene Analysis in Different B cell Lymphomas : With Focus on Cellular Origin and Antigen Selection
Sammanfattning : B cell lymphoma (BCL) comprises a biologically and clinically heterogeneous group of tumors deriving from different stages of B cell development. The immunoglobulin (Ig) variable heavy chain (VH) gene rearrangement is unique for each BCL and can be used to reveal cellular origin, to study signs of antigen selection and to quantify tumor cell load.
